Below at TIAA, we're big supporters of dealt with annuities and the guaranteed life time revenue they offer in retirement..1 We do not talk nearly as much regarding variable annuities, even though TIAA pioneered the initial variable annuity back in 1952.
Money alloted to a variable annuity is bought subaccounts of different asset courses: supplies, bonds, money market, etc. Variable annuity performance is tied to the hidden returns of the picked subaccounts. Throughout the accumulation phasepreretirement, in other wordsvariable annuities are comparable to common funds (albeit with an insurance coverage wrapper that impacts the price but can include some defense).
That conversion is known as annuitization. Individuals are under no obligation to annuitize, and those who do not typically make withdrawals equally as they would with a shared fund. Nonetheless, retirees that count on a withdrawal method run the risk of outliving their cost savings, whereas those who go with life time earnings know they'll get a check every montheven if they live to 100 or beyond.
Variable annuities normally have an assumed financial investment return (AIR), generally in between 3% and 7%, that identifies a conventional regular monthly payment. If the financial investment performance is higher than the AIR, you'll get even more than the basic settlement.

With a taken care of annuity, the month-to-month payment you receive at age 67 is usually the same as the one you'll get at 87which would be fine if the price of food, real estate and treatment weren't rising. Repayments from a variable annuity are more probable to keep pace with rising cost of living due to the fact that the returns can be connected to the stock market.
As soon as annuitized, a variable annuity ends up being a set-it-and-forget-it source of retired life income. You do not need to decide how much to take out each month because the choice has currently been madeyour settlement is based upon the efficiency of the underlying subaccounts. This is practical since people are a lot more vulnerable to cash blunders as they age.
